Skip to content

Commit 168a03c

Browse files
AttributeAwareInterface - Refactoring
- moved to NiceshopsDev\NiceCore\Attribute
1 parent 76a5724 commit 168a03c

File tree

5 files changed

+33
-36
lines changed

5 files changed

+33
-36
lines changed

src/AttributeAwareInterface.php renamed to src/Attribute/AttributeAwareInterface.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
* @license https://github.com/niceshops/nice-core/blob/master/LICENSE BSD 3-Clause License
55
*/
66

7-
namespace NiceshopsDev\NiceCore;
7+
namespace NiceshopsDev\NiceCore\Attribute;
88

99
/**
1010
* Interface AttributeAwareInterface

src/Traits/AttributeTrait.php renamed to src/Attribute/AttributeTrait.php

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-5,10 +5,9 @@
55
* @license https://github.com/niceshops/nice-core/blob/master/LICENSE BSD 3-Clause License
66
*/
77

8-
namespace NiceshopsDev\NiceCore\Traits;
8+
namespace NiceshopsDev\NiceCore\Attribute;
99

1010
use NiceshopsDev\NiceCore\Exception;
11-
use NiceshopsDev\NiceCore\StrictAttributeAwareInterface;
1211

1312
/**
1413
* Trait AttributeTrait
@@ -245,7 +244,7 @@ public function __call($name, $arguments)
245244
* @param $name
246245
* @param $value
247246
*
248-
* @return self|static
247+
* @return self
249248
* @throws Exception
250249
*/
251250
public function __set($name, $value)

src/StrictAttributeAwareInterface.php renamed to src/Attribute/StrictAttributeAwareInterface.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
* @license https://github.com/niceshops/nice-core/blob/master/LICENSE BSD 3-Clause License
55
*/
66

7-
namespace NiceshopsDev\NiceCore;
7+
namespace NiceshopsDev\NiceCore\Attribute;
88

99
/**
1010
* Interface StrictAttributeAwareInterface

test/Traits/AttributeTraitTest.php renamed to test/Attribute/AttributeTraitTest.php

Lines changed: 28 additions & 30 deletions
Original file line numberDiff line numberDiff line change
@@ -5,21 +5,19 @@
55
* @license https://github.com/niceshops/nice-core/blob/master/LICENSE BSD 3-Clause License
66
*/
77

8-
namespace NiceshopsDev\NiceCore\Traits;
8+
namespace NiceshopsDev\NiceCore\Attribute;
99

10-
use NiceshopsDev\NiceCore\AttributeAwareInterface;
1110
use NiceshopsDev\NiceCore\Exception;
1211
use NiceshopsDev\NiceCore\PHPUnit\DefaultTestCase;
13-
use NiceshopsDev\NiceCore\StrictAttributeAwareInterface;
1412
use PHPUnit\Framework\MockObject\MockObject;
1513
use ReflectionException;
1614
use stdClass;
1715

1816
/**
1917
* Class AttributeTraitTest
2018
* @coversDefaultClass AttributeTrait
21-
* @uses \NiceshopsDev\NiceCore\Traits\AttributeTrait
22-
* @package Niceshops\Library\Core\Traits
19+
* @uses \NiceshopsDev\NiceCore\Attribute\AttributeTrait
20+
* @package NiceshopsDev\NiceCore
2321
*/
2422
class AttributeTraitTest extends DefaultTestCase
2523
{
@@ -98,7 +96,7 @@ public function normalizeAttributeKeyDataProvider()
9896
*
9997
* @dataProvider normalizeAttributeKeyDataProvider
10098
*
101-
* @covers \NiceshopsDev\NiceCore\Traits\AttributeTrait::normalizeAttributeKey()
99+
* @covers \NiceshopsDev\NiceCore\Attribute\AttributeTrait::normalizeAttributeKey()
102100
*
103101
* @param string $key
104102
* @param string $expectedKey
@@ -250,9 +248,9 @@ public function getSetUnsetDataProvider()
250248
*
251249
* @dataProvider getSetUnsetDataProvider
252250
*
253-
* @covers \NiceshopsDev\NiceCore\Traits\AttributeTrait::getAttribute()
254-
* @covers \NiceshopsDev\NiceCore\Traits\AttributeTrait::setAttribute()
255-
* @covers \NiceshopsDev\NiceCore\Traits\AttributeTrait::unsetAttribute()
251+
* @covers \NiceshopsDev\NiceCore\Attribute\AttributeTrait::getAttribute()
252+
* @covers \NiceshopsDev\NiceCore\Attribute\AttributeTrait::setAttribute()
253+
* @covers \NiceshopsDev\NiceCore\Attribute\AttributeTrait::unsetAttribute()
256254
*
257255
* @param array $arrAttribute
258256
* @param array $arrExpectedValue
@@ -306,11 +304,11 @@ public function testGetSetUnsetAttribute(array $arrAttribute, array $arrExpected
306304
* @group unit
307305
* @small
308306
*
309-
* @covers \NiceshopsDev\NiceCore\Traits\AttributeTrait::lockAttribute()
310-
* @covers \NiceshopsDev\NiceCore\Traits\AttributeTrait::unlockAttribute()
307+
* @covers \NiceshopsDev\NiceCore\Attribute\AttributeTrait::lockAttribute()
308+
* @covers \NiceshopsDev\NiceCore\Attribute\AttributeTrait::unlockAttribute()
311309
* @throws Exception
312-
* @uses \NiceshopsDev\NiceCore\Traits\AttributeTrait::setAttribute()
313-
* @uses \NiceshopsDev\NiceCore\Traits\AttributeTrait::getAttribute()
310+
* @uses \NiceshopsDev\NiceCore\Attribute\AttributeTrait::setAttribute()
311+
* @uses \NiceshopsDev\NiceCore\Attribute\AttributeTrait::getAttribute()
314312
*/
315313
public function testLockUnlockAttribute()
316314
{
@@ -386,16 +384,16 @@ public function getAttributeListDataProvider()
386384
*
387385
* @dataProvider getAttributeListDataProvider
388386
*
389-
* @covers \NiceshopsDev\NiceCore\Traits\AttributeTrait::getAttribute_List()
390-
* @covers \NiceshopsDev\NiceCore\Traits\AttributeTrait::getAttributes()
387+
* @covers \NiceshopsDev\NiceCore\Attribute\AttributeTrait::getAttribute_List()
388+
* @covers \NiceshopsDev\NiceCore\Attribute\AttributeTrait::getAttributes()
391389
*
392390
* @param array $arrAttribute
393391
* @param array $expectedValue
394392
*
395393
* @param string|null $expectecException
396394
*
397395
* @throws Exception
398-
* @uses \NiceshopsDev\NiceCore\Traits\AttributeTrait::setAttribute()
396+
* @uses \NiceshopsDev\NiceCore\Attribute\AttributeTrait::setAttribute()
399397
*/
400398
public function testGetAttributeList(array $arrAttribute, array $expectedValue, string $expectecException = null)
401399
{
@@ -418,10 +416,10 @@ public function testGetAttributeList(array $arrAttribute, array $expectedValue,
418416
* @group unit
419417
* @small
420418
*
421-
* @covers \NiceshopsDev\NiceCore\Traits\AttributeTrait::__call()
419+
* @covers \NiceshopsDev\NiceCore\Attribute\AttributeTrait::__call()
422420
* @throws ReflectionException
423421
* @throws Exception
424-
* @uses \NiceshopsDev\NiceCore\Traits\AttributeTrait::getAttribute()
422+
* @uses \NiceshopsDev\NiceCore\Attribute\AttributeTrait::getAttribute()
425423
* @noinspection PhpUndefinedMethodInspection
426424
*/
427425
public function testMagicAttributeAccess_with_Call()
@@ -454,10 +452,10 @@ public function testMagicAttributeAccess_with_Call()
454452
* @group unit
455453
* @small
456454
*
457-
* @covers \NiceshopsDev\NiceCore\Traits\AttributeTrait::__get()
455+
* @covers \NiceshopsDev\NiceCore\Attribute\AttributeTrait::__get()
458456
* @throws Exception
459-
* @uses \NiceshopsDev\NiceCore\Traits\AttributeTrait::getAttribute()
460-
* @uses \NiceshopsDev\NiceCore\Traits\AttributeTrait::setAttribute()
457+
* @uses \NiceshopsDev\NiceCore\Attribute\AttributeTrait::getAttribute()
458+
* @uses \NiceshopsDev\NiceCore\Attribute\AttributeTrait::setAttribute()
461459
* @noinspection PhpUndefinedFieldInspection
462460
*/
463461
public function testMagicAttributeAccess_with_Get()
@@ -477,9 +475,9 @@ public function testMagicAttributeAccess_with_Get()
477475
* @group unit
478476
* @small
479477
*
480-
* @covers \NiceshopsDev\NiceCore\Traits\AttributeTrait::__set()
478+
* @covers \NiceshopsDev\NiceCore\Attribute\AttributeTrait::__set()
481479
* @throws Exception
482-
* @uses \NiceshopsDev\NiceCore\Traits\AttributeTrait::getAttribute()
480+
* @uses \NiceshopsDev\NiceCore\Attribute\AttributeTrait::getAttribute()
483481
* @noinspection PhpUndefinedFieldInspection
484482
*/
485483
public function testMagicAttributeAccess_with_Set()
@@ -498,11 +496,11 @@ public function testMagicAttributeAccess_with_Set()
498496
* @group unit
499497
* @small
500498
*
501-
* @covers \NiceshopsDev\NiceCore\Traits\AttributeTrait::__set()
502-
* @covers \NiceshopsDev\NiceCore\Traits\AttributeTrait::__get()
503-
* @covers \NiceshopsDev\NiceCore\Traits\AttributeTrait::__call()
504-
* @uses \NiceshopsDev\NiceCore\Traits\AttributeTrait::setAttribute()
505-
* @uses \NiceshopsDev\NiceCore\Traits\AttributeTrait::getAttribute()
499+
* @covers \NiceshopsDev\NiceCore\Attribute\AttributeTrait::__set()
500+
* @covers \NiceshopsDev\NiceCore\Attribute\AttributeTrait::__get()
501+
* @covers \NiceshopsDev\NiceCore\Attribute\AttributeTrait::__call()
502+
* @uses \NiceshopsDev\NiceCore\Attribute\AttributeTrait::setAttribute()
503+
* @uses \NiceshopsDev\NiceCore\Attribute\AttributeTrait::getAttribute()
506504
* @noinspection PhpUndefinedFieldInspection
507505
* @noinspection PhpUndefinedMethodInspection
508506
*/
@@ -560,9 +558,9 @@ public function __construct()
560558
* @group unit
561559
* @small
562560
*
563-
* @covers \NiceshopsDev\NiceCore\Traits\AttributeTrait::hasAttribute()
561+
* @covers \NiceshopsDev\NiceCore\Attribute\AttributeTrait::hasAttribute()
564562
* @throws Exception
565-
* @uses \NiceshopsDev\NiceCore\Traits\AttributeTrait::setAttribute()
563+
* @uses \NiceshopsDev\NiceCore\Attribute\AttributeTrait::setAttribute()
566564
*/
567565
public function testHasAttribute()
568566
{

test/PHPUnit/DefaultTestCaseTest.php

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@
77

88
namespace NiceshopsDev\NiceCore\PHPUnit;
99

10-
use NiceshopsDev\NiceCore\Traits\AttributeTrait;
10+
use NiceshopsDev\NiceCore\Attribute\AttributeTrait;
1111
use NiceshopsDev\NiceCore\Traits\OptionTrait;
1212
use PHPUnit\Framework\MockObject\MockObject;
1313
use PHPUnit\Framework\TestCase;

0 commit comments

Comments
 (0)